You and your family are moving to another country for work, and you are looking to buy a house there.
Write a letter to a property agent. In your letter:
Introduce yourself and your family
Describe the type of accommodation that you hope to find
Give your preference for the location of the accommodation
Dear Sir/Madam,
I am writing this letter to express my interest in purchasing a house and know about the options available to you.
My name is Chirag, and I dwell with my household in India. I have been working as an accountant manager in a leading firm for more than ten years. We are immigrating to Canada next month due to a business requirement and would abide there permanently.
Furthermore, we are looking to buy a villa in Toronto so that we could reside and work comfortably. We would like to acquire an accommodation, which is a three bedroom house with individual washrooms. Moreover, a small garden and swimming pool is a must for us to relax on our weekends.
Additionally, the downtown location would be optimal as commuting to my office would take less time. Besides, I have heard there are several educational institutions, which would be propitious for our children to reach school readily. Therefore, I would request you equip some metro area properties as that is our first choice.
I look forward to hearing from you soon.
Yours faithfully,
Chirag Bhardwaj
